Customizing the Location of Git Global Configuration Files on Windows: Methods and Best Practices
This article provides a comprehensive analysis of methods to change the storage location of the Git global configuration file .gitconfig on Windows systems. By default, Git stores this file in the user's home directory, but users may prefer to relocate it to a custom path such as c:\my_configuration_files\. The primary method discussed is setting the HOME environment variable, which is the standard and most effective approach recommended by Git. Additionally, alternative techniques are explored, including using symbolic links, Git's include mechanism for configuration files, and the newer GIT_CONFIG_GLOBAL environment variable available in recent Git versions. Each method is examined in detail, covering its underlying principles, step-by-step implementation, advantages, disadvantages, and suitable use cases. The article also addresses compatibility considerations when modifying environment variables and offers practical command-line examples and precautions to ensure a safe and reliable configuration process. This guide aims to help users select the optimal strategy based on their specific needs and system constraints.
